If you shoot them in the head there is zero difference, have killed a ton of them with both. A air rifle is very effective if you can shoot and hit what your shooting at, chest shots even with .22 cal can result in them getting to a hole or hanging up in the tree.. best to take head shots always, just wait for a good shot, another good shot is underneath the chin thru the neck into spine.
If using .177 dont use hard cheap pellets like crosman as they expand very little better to get JSB Diablo pellets.
